The interview at Daesang lasted for a total of 90 minutes and was conducted in a 4:4 format. The interview panel consisted of two executives, one team leader, and one HR representative. The interview duration was relatively long, starting with common questions followed by sequential answers from each candidate. Follow-up questions were asked based on the responses given.
